Wine, born about 11,000 years ago in the regions of the Caucasus and the Fertile Crescent, is not just a simple food product. It represents much more than that, thanks to its strong symbolism and its role as a pleasure drink. In Wine: 60 Keys to Understanding Oenology, Fabienne Remize and Véronique Cheynier offer a comprehensive guide to discovering this fascinating world.
Through 60 essential questions, this book covers all aspects of wine, from its history to its economy, including the secrets of its production, whether it be sweet, sparkling, or dry wines. You will learn what makes a great wine, what an AOP is, a terroir, and how the color of a wine can be controlled.
The book also addresses the sensory diversity of wines, the mysteries of their aging, and the tools available to oenologists to optimize the quality of wines. In addition to the technical aspects, this book also explores current major challenges, such as the impact of climate change and the new health and environmental constraints facing the wine sector.
Accessible and illustrated with concrete examples, Wine: 60 Keys to Understanding Oenology is aimed at both enthusiasts and professionals seeking a better understanding of the wine world.
